Langchain Serpapi, tools import tool class … Compare Tavily alternatives for AI search and RAG pipelines.

Langchain Serpapi, SerpAPIWrapper in langchain_community. Python API reference for utilities. Tavily, Exa, Brave, Serper, SerpAPI, Perplexity Sonar, and You. langchain-core:基本抽象和 LangChain 表达式语言。 langchain-community:第三方集成。 合作伙伴包(例如 langchain-openai, langchain-anthropic 等):某 To ensure the agent uses a specific tool, such as SerpAPI, there isn’t a direct option in n8n to force it. This page includes lists of LangChain 是一个模块化的框架,其功能由多个核心库和扩展库组成,涵盖了从语言模型交互到外部数据处理、记忆管理、工具调用等多个方面。 AI Financial Research Agent An AI agent for real-time stock research and financial analysis, built with LangChain and OpenAI. By integrating SerpAPI with st. Discover the best guide to build AI agent with LangChain now. Most do, yes. The quickest way to add basic web search to any LangChain-based agent. md File metadata and controls Preview Code Blame 461 lines (355 loc) · 22. 最近想用 LangChain 结合搜索引擎的返回结果,然后由LLM结合query进行回答问题,所以查了一下网上申请搜索引擎API接口的用法,先前试用过Bing搜索的内 from typing import Optional # from pydantic import BaseModel, Field import serpapi from langchain. 14-step tutorial with tools, memory, human-in-the-loop, and deployment patterns. Step-by-step guide with Python and TypeScript code examples. SerpAPI — Structured Google search results for agents. Contribute to Nefelibata-a/Travel-agent development by creating an account on GitHub. As Matt Collins documents in his LLM search API guide, tool-calling in LangChain offers one of the most powerful and efficient frameworks for agentic AI development. Tavily LangChain provides official wrappers for Tavily (`TavilySearchResults`) and community wrappers for Brave and SerpAPI. 6. Advanced AI LangChain in n8n LangChain concepts in n8n This page explains how LangChain concepts and features map to n8n nodes. Contribute to cactt/doc-geektime-docs development by creating an account on GitHub. 2 KB Raw 👏极客时间 pdf & markdown 文档. text_input("SERP Title: Please add n8n-nodes-serpapi (Google Search) as verified community node for n8n. 加餐二-不用Langchain也能调用函数,一起来学Function Calling. title('LangChain Search') # Get OpenAI API key, SERP API key and search query openai_api_key = st. Part of the LangChain ecosystem. It is broken into two parts: installation and setup, and then references to the specific SerpAPI wrapper. serpapi in langchain_community. tools import tool class Compare Tavily alternatives for AI search and RAG pipelines. Python API reference for utilities. While the LangChain framework can be used standalone, it also integrates seamlessly with any LangChain product, giving developers a full suite of tools when building LLM applications. To use, you should have the google-search-results python package installed, and the environment variable SERPAPI_API_KEY set with your API key, or pass serpapi_api_key as Learn how to integrate Serpapi with LangChain using the Model Context Protocol (MCP). serpapi. If deploying a LangChain agent on a Linux production server, we‘ll want to optimize resource usage. Ask AI questions from PDFs (LangChain + FAISS) Auto-email summarizer agent (Python + OpenAI API) CRM Assistant using Airtable + DuckDuckGo Search via LangChain — Zero cost, no API key required. However, you can guide the AI by specifying this in the prompt itself. Wrapper around SerpAPI. . cloud Description: I’d like to use SerpApi in my cloud workflows for Google Search automation. The default setup makes a new API call to OpenAI and SerpAPI on every query. text_input("OpenAI API Key", type="password") serpapi_api_key = st. Contribute to severian42/ANIMA-LangChain development by creating an account on GitHub. This page covers how to use the SerpAPI search APIs within LangChain. Learn step-by-step how to use Python and LangChain to create real AI agents powered by OpenAI and SerpAPI tools. Build a production-ready AI agent with LangGraph 1. com all have first-party or community LangChain integrations, and most also have LlamaIndex packs. pydantic_v1 import BaseModel, Field from langchain_core. 1 and Python. Understand the fundamentals of Artificial Intelligence (AI) and how it differs from SerpAPI is a Search Engine Results Page (SERP) API that provides an easy way to retrieve search engine results in a structured format. This module contains safer versions for some of the most used LangChain tools. Side-by-side pricing for Tavily, Exa, Serper, and SerpAPI with content extraction and semantic search features. vk, kpwh2za, 9sz8w, c9w5, bx9, tt, nb5, kbo, ir, k0if,